Sarhul teaches the art of co-existence: Lalit Das

Mail News Service

Jamshedpur: City-based social organization Lok Samarpan organized a service camp near Bhalubasa Kali temple on the occasion of Sarhul.

Leading the programme, the outfit president and patron Lalit Das felicitated the representatives of various tribal communities by presenting them traditional �gamchha� (towel).

Congratulating the people on Sarhul, Das said the festival taught one and all how to maintain balance with Mother Nature and co-exist with all creatures. Sarhul is a festival of the soil and ancient tribal culture and traditions, he said.

A large number of people visited the camp where the outfit members distributed fruits, beverage, chocolates and mineral water.

The camp organizers included Neeraj Kumar, Subhash Mukhi, Ritesh Dutta, Deepak Singh, Ankit Verma, Devashish and Pradip Dubey.
